One of the artists whose work is found on the Bridges site (www.bridgesmathart.org/) is George Hart. Dr. Hart is Chief of Content at the Museum of Mathematics in Manhattan. He has had an extensive multi-disciplinary career that has made use of his many talents including his awesome skills as a sculptor, mathematician, computer scientist, engineer, writer, and educator.

While the Museum of Mathematics is expected to open in late-2012, it offers Math Encounters,  a public presentation series celebrating the spectacular world of mathematics. The next session, The Shape of Space: An Exploration of Multiconnected Universes, is scheduled for Wednesday, February 1, The presentations are designed to help increase the public's understanding mathematics by sharing the many connections the subject has in our lives.
